About Lincoln Recovery — Detox Treatment
Situated in Raymond, Illinois, Lincoln Recovery is dedicated to providing a wide range of addiction treatment services tailored for both adults and young adults. The center specializes in detoxification and substance use treatment, with a keen focus on co-occurring disorders, which may include serious mental health illnesses in adults or serious emotional disturbances in children. Lincoln Recovery offers several programs designed to meet diverse needs, including long-term residential care, residential detoxification, and a 24-hour residential program. The facility emphasizes individualized care, employing various evidence-based approaches such as 12-step facilitation, anger management, and brief interventions. Both male and female clients can take advantage of the center’s customized treatment plans, which are designed to ensure high-quality care and support throughout their recovery journey.

Detox & Residential Programs at Lincoln Recovery
| Type of Care | Detoxification, Substance use treatment, Treatment for co-occurring substance use plus either serious mental health illness in adults/serious emotional disturbance in children |
| Service Settings | Long-term residential, Residential detoxification, Residential/24-hour residential, Short-term residential |
| Medications Offered | Buprenorphine used in Treatment, Naltrexone used in Treatment |

This center provides medication-assisted treatment (MAT) using Buprenorphine used in Treatment, Naltrexone used in Treatment. These FDA-approved medications help manage withdrawal symptoms and reduce cravings. A physician will determine the appropriate protocol based on your individual assessment.
Inpatient programs typically follow a structured schedule that includes morning wellness activities, individual therapy sessions, group counseling, educational workshops, and evening recovery meetings. Meals, medication management, and rest periods are built into each day. The consistent routine helps establish healthy habits that support long-term sobriety.
